[jira] [Commented] (ZOOKEEPER-3263) Illegal reflective access in zookeer's kerberosUtil
[ https://issues.apache.org/jira/browse/ZOOKEEPER-3263?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16844390#comment-16844390 ] Hudson commented on ZOOKEEPER-3263: --- SUCCESS: Integrated in Jenkins build ZooKeeper-trunk #530 (See [https://builds.apache.org/job/ZooKeeper-trunk/530/]) ZOOKEEPER-3263: JAVA9/11 Warnings: Illegal reflective access in (eolivelli: rev 777f0c15e73a8401a648c3cff93d20b3d3e4ee17) *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LearnerHandlerMetricsT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/util/SerializeUtilsTest.java * (edit) ivy.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/ClientReconnectT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LeaderBeanTest.java * (edit) zookeeper-server/pom.xml * (edit) build.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/PrepRequestProcessorMetricsT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/ConnectionMetricsT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/FinalRequestProcessorTest.java * (edit) zookeeper-docs/pom.xml * (edit) zookeeper-server/src/main/java/org/apache/zookeeper/server/util/KerberosUtil.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LearnerHandlerT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/RemotePeerBeanTest.java * (edit) pom.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LocalPeerBeanT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/WatchLeakT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/QuorumPeerMainTest.java > Illegal reflective access in zookeer's kerberosUtil > --- > > Key: ZOOKEEPER-3263 > URL: https://issues.apache.org/jira/browse/ZOOKEEPER-3263 > Project: ZooKeeper > Issue Type: Improvement >Affects Versions: 3.4.13 >Reporter: Pradeep Bansal >Assignee: Andor Molnar >Priority: Major > Labels: pull-request-available > Fix For: 3.6.0 > > Time Spent: 2h > Remaining Estimate: 0h > > I am using kafka 2.11-2.1.0 with Java 11. Kafka is using zookeeper-3.4.13.jar > and when am running kafka-acl script to maange ACLs, I am getting below > warning. Is there a way to resolve this? > {{WARNING: An illegal reflective access operation has occurred WARNING: > Illegal reflective access by org.apache.zookeeper.server.util.KerberosUtil > (file://apache/kafka/kafka_2.11-2.1.0/libs/zookeeper-3.4.13.jar) to method > sun.security.krb5.Config.getInstance() WARNING: Please consider reporting > this to the maintainers of org.apache.zookeeper.server.util.KerberosUtil > WARNING: Use --illegal-access=warn to enable warnings of further illegal > reflective access operations WARNING: All illegal access operations will be > denied in a future release}} -- This message was sent by Atlassian JIRA (v7.6.3#76005)
[jira] [Commented] (ZOOKEEPER-3263) Illegal reflective access in zookeer's kerberosUtil
[ https://issues.apache.org/jira/browse/ZOOKEEPER-3263?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16844304#comment-16844304 ] Hudson commented on ZOOKEEPER-3263: --- SUCCESS: Integrated in Jenkins build Zookeeper-trunk-single-thread #364 (See [https://builds.apache.org/job/Zookeeper-trunk-single-thread/364/]) ZOOKEEPER-3263: JAVA9/11 Warnings: Illegal reflective access in (eolivelli: rev 777f0c15e73a8401a648c3cff93d20b3d3e4ee17) *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LearnerHandlerTest.java * (edit) zookeeper-docs/pom.xml * (edit) ivy.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/PrepRequestProcessorMetricsT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LeaderBeanT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/util/SerializeUtilsTest.java * (edit) zookeeper-server/pom.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/FinalRequestProcessorTest.java * (edit) zookeeper-server/src/main/java/org/apache/zookeeper/server/util/KerberosUtil.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/QuorumPeerMainT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/WatchLeakTest.java * (edit) pom.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LearnerHandlerMetricsTest.java * (edit) build.xml *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/ClientReconnectT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/ConnectionMetricsT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/LocalPeerBeanTest.java * (edit) zookeeper-server/src/test/java/org/apache/zookeeper/server/quorum/RemotePeerBeanTest.java > Illegal reflective access in zookeer's kerberosUtil > --- > > Key: ZOOKEEPER-3263 > URL: https://issues.apache.org/jira/browse/ZOOKEEPER-3263 > Project: ZooKeeper > Issue Type: Improvement >Affects Versions: 3.4.13 >Reporter: Pradeep Bansal >Assignee: Andor Molnar >Priority: Major > Labels: pull-request-available > Fix For: 3.6.0 > > Time Spent: 2h > Remaining Estimate: 0h > > I am using kafka 2.11-2.1.0 with Java 11. Kafka is using zookeeper-3.4.13.jar > and when am running kafka-acl script to maange ACLs, I am getting below > warning. Is there a way to resolve this? > {{WARNING: An illegal reflective access operation has occurred WARNING: > Illegal reflective access by org.apache.zookeeper.server.util.KerberosUtil > (file://apache/kafka/kafka_2.11-2.1.0/libs/zookeeper-3.4.13.jar) to method > sun.security.krb5.Config.getInstance() WARNING: Please consider reporting > this to the maintainers of org.apache.zookeeper.server.util.KerberosUtil > WARNING: Use --illegal-access=warn to enable warnings of further illegal > reflective access operations WARNING: All illegal access operations will be > denied in a future release}} -- This message was sent by Atlassian JIRA (v7.6.3#76005)
[jira] [Commented] (ZOOKEEPER-3263) Illegal reflective access in zookeer's kerberosUtil
[ https://issues.apache.org/jira/browse/ZOOKEEPER-3263?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16840556#comment-16840556 ] Andor Molnar commented on ZOOKEEPER-3263: - Issues that I've found so far: {noformat} WARNING: Illegal reflective access by org.apache.ivy.util.url.IvyAuthenticator (file:/Users/andormolnar/git/my-zookeeper/zookeeper-server/src/main/resources/lib/ivy-2.4.0.jar) to field java.net.Authenticator.theAuthenticator{noformat} Upgrade ivy {noformat} WARNING: Illegal reflective access by org.mockito.cglib.core.ReflectUtils$2 (file:/Users/andormolnar/git/my-zookeeper/build/test/lib/mockito-all-1.8.5.jar) to method java.lang.ClassLoader.defineClass(java.lang.String,byte[],int,int,java.security.ProtectionDomain){noformat} Upgrade mockito {noformat} WARNING: Illegal reflective access by org.apache.zookeeper.server.util.KerberosUtil (file:/Users/andormolnar/git/my-zookeeper/build/classes/) to method sun.security.krb5.Config.getInstance() {noformat} Patch {{KerberosUtil}} I'm going to put together a patch to address these issues on all branches tomorrow. > Illegal reflective access in zookeer's kerberosUtil > --- > > Key: ZOOKEEPER-3263 > URL: https://issues.apache.org/jira/browse/ZOOKEEPER-3263 > Project: ZooKeeper > Issue Type: Improvement >Affects Versions: 3.4.13 >Reporter: Pradeep Bansal >Priority: Major > > I am using kafka 2.11-2.1.0 with Java 11. Kafka is using zookeeper-3.4.13.jar > and when am running kafka-acl script to maange ACLs, I am getting below > warning. Is there a way to resolve this? > {{WARNING: An illegal reflective access operation has occurred WARNING: > Illegal reflective access by org.apache.zookeeper.server.util.KerberosUtil > (file://apache/kafka/kafka_2.11-2.1.0/libs/zookeeper-3.4.13.jar) to method > sun.security.krb5.Config.getInstance() WARNING: Please consider reporting > this to the maintainers of org.apache.zookeeper.server.util.KerberosUtil > WARNING: Use --illegal-access=warn to enable warnings of further illegal > reflective access operations WARNING: All illegal access operations will be > denied in a future release}} -- This message was sent by Atlassian JIRA (v7.6.3#76005)
[jira] [Commented] (ZOOKEEPER-3263) Illegal reflective access in zookeer's kerberosUtil
[ https://issues.apache.org/jira/browse/ZOOKEEPER-3263?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16840544#comment-16840544 ] Andor Molnar commented on ZOOKEEPER-3263: - [~bansalp] Would you please confirm which versions of ZooKeeper are affected by this Java 9 warning? Is that correct that you tested with 3.4.13? > Illegal reflective access in zookeer's kerberosUtil > --- > > Key: ZOOKEEPER-3263 > URL: https://issues.apache.org/jira/browse/ZOOKEEPER-3263 > Project: ZooKeeper > Issue Type: Improvement >Reporter: Pradeep Bansal >Priority: Major > > I am using kafka 2.11-2.1.0 with Java 11. Kafka is using zookeeper-3.4.13.jar > and when am running kafka-acl script to maange ACLs, I am getting below > warning. Is there a way to resolve this? > {{WARNING: An illegal reflective access operation has occurred WARNING: > Illegal reflective access by org.apache.zookeeper.server.util.KerberosUtil > (file://apache/kafka/kafka_2.11-2.1.0/libs/zookeeper-3.4.13.jar) to method > sun.security.krb5.Config.getInstance() WARNING: Please consider reporting > this to the maintainers of org.apache.zookeeper.server.util.KerberosUtil > WARNING: Use --illegal-access=warn to enable warnings of further illegal > reflective access operations WARNING: All illegal access operations will be > denied in a future release}} -- This message was sent by Atlassian JIRA (v7.6.3#76005)
[jira] [Commented] (ZOOKEEPER-3263) Illegal reflective access in zookeer's kerberosUtil
[ https://issues.apache.org/jira/browse/ZOOKEEPER-3263?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16836183#comment-16836183 ] Adam Antal commented on ZOOKEEPER-3263: --- It looks quite similar to HADOOP-10848. This is due to JDK9+ blocking accesses to sun.* classes. You can find more information in that case. Also, it's probably need a patch from ZK side to remove this though. > Illegal reflective access in zookeer's kerberosUtil > --- > > Key: ZOOKEEPER-3263 > URL: https://issues.apache.org/jira/browse/ZOOKEEPER-3263 > Project: ZooKeeper > Issue Type: Improvement >Reporter: Pradeep Bansal >Priority: Major > > I am using kafka 2.11-2.1.0 with Java 11. Kafka is using zookeeper-3.4.13.jar > and when am running kafka-acl script to maange ACLs, I am getting below > warning. Is there a way to resolve this? > {{WARNING: An illegal reflective access operation has occurred WARNING: > Illegal reflective access by org.apache.zookeeper.server.util.KerberosUtil > (file://apache/kafka/kafka_2.11-2.1.0/libs/zookeeper-3.4.13.jar) to method > sun.security.krb5.Config.getInstance() WARNING: Please consider reporting > this to the maintainers of org.apache.zookeeper.server.util.KerberosUtil > WARNING: Use --illegal-access=warn to enable warnings of further illegal > reflective access operations WARNING: All illegal access operations will be > denied in a future release}} -- This message was sent by Atlassian JIRA (v7.6.3#76005)